The 1N3735R is a semiconductor diode belonging to the category of rectifier diodes.
It is commonly used in power supply and rectification circuits.
The 1N3735R is typically available in a DO-201AD package.
It is usually pack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The 1N3735R has a standard two-pin configuration, with the anode and cathode clearly marked for easy identification.
The 1N3735R operates based on the principle of unidirectional conduction, allowing current flow in one direction while blocking it in the opposite direction. When forward biased, it allows current to pass through with minimal voltage drop, making it suitable for rectification purposes.
The 1N3735R is widely used in various electronic devices and systems, including: - Power supply units - Battery chargers - Inverters - Switching power supplies - LED lighting systems
Some alternative models to the 1N3735R include: - 1N4004: Similar voltage and current ratings - 1N5408: Higher voltage and current ratings - UF4007: Faster switching speed
